1. Types of Black Skirts You Need to Know

1.1 Mini Black Skirts
If you’re after something fun, flirty, and definitely a little daring, a mini black skirt is your go-to. It’s perfect for those laid-back, casual outings—think weekend shopping trips, hanging with friends, or even a casual date night. Pair it with a loose sweater, a fitted top, or a graphic tee and you’re good to go. Throw on some ankle boots or sneakers for an effortlessly cool vibe.
1.2 Midi Black Skirts
The midi black skirt is super versatile and totally a fashion favorite. It hits right below the knee, so you get the perfect balance of elegance and comfort. Whether you’re running errands, having lunch with friends, or even attending a casual office meeting, a midi skirt has your back. Just pair it with a tucked-in blouse or a cozy knit, and you’ll look effortlessly chic.
1.3 Maxi Black Skirts
For a more elegant look, a maxi black skirt is an easy choice. It’s flowy, graceful, and makes a big statement, especially when paired with a silk or satin top. Whether you’re heading to a wedding or a fancy evening out, a maxi black skirt never disappoints. A simple fitted blouse and some heels will give you that red carpet-ready look—minus the fuss.
1.4 Pencil Black Skirts
Want to keep it sleek and professional? The pencil black skirt is the one for you. It’s tight, flattering, and does wonders for creating a clean, polished silhouette. Perfect for workdays, business meetings, or any event where you need to look put-together but still stylish. Pair it with a tailored blouse, a sharp blazer, and some pumps, and you’ll be ready to own that conference call.
1.5 Pleated Black Skirts
For something that gives a little more movement and texture, go for a pleated black skirt. It’s a fun, flirty piece that can easily go from casual to semi-formal. For a laid-back look, wear it with a comfy sweater and sneakers. For a more dressed-up vibe, pair it with a blouse and heels. The best part? It’s super comfy and still looks chic.

2. Popular Materials for Black Skirts

2.1 Denim Black Skirts
Denim is always a win when it comes to casual looks. A denim black skirt is perfect for those everyday outfits where comfort meets style. It’s durable, easy to move in, and goes with just about everything. Try it with a t-shirt, a cute blouse, or even a hoodie for an effortlessly cool vibe. Pair it with sneakers or flats, and you’re all set.

2.2 Leather Black Skirts
Want to add a little edge to your wardrobe? A leather black skirt is your best friend. It’s bold, it’s stylish, and it definitely stands out. A great option for evenings out, a party, or any event where you want to make a statement. Pair it with a sleek top, a leather jacket, or even a bold print to keep the look fresh.
2.3 Satin and Silk Black Skirts
For those occasions when you need to look extra polished, a satin or silk black skirt is the way to go. These fabrics scream luxury and elegance. Perfect for formal events, evening parties, or a dinner date where you want to shine. Pair it with a delicate blouse, add a sparkly clutch, and you’ll be the center of attention.

3. Styling Your Black Skirt for Every Occasion
3.1 Office Wear Outfits
If you’re looking for something professional but still fashionable, a pencil black skirt is your best bet. Pair it with a crisp button-down shirt, a tailored blazer, and some classy pumps for a work-ready look. Not feeling the pencil skirt? No worries—opt for a midi black skirt with a fitted top or sweater for a more relaxed but still office-appropriate vibe.
3.2 Casual Wear Outfits
For those easygoing days when you just want to throw something on and look put-together, a denim black skirt is perfect. Style it with a graphic tee or cozy sweater and some comfy sneakers. Add a crossbody bag for an effortlessly chic vibe. Alternatively, a pleated black skirt works wonders when you want a mix of comfort and fun style.
3.3 Evening and Formal Outfits
When the occasion calls for something more formal, go for a satin or silk black skirt. These fabrics add instant elegance. Pair your skirt with a stunning top—think a silk blouse, a sequined top, or anything that sparkles. Finish off with high heels, and you’ll be ready for any special event.

4. Choosing the Right Black Skirt Based on Body Type
4.1 For Hourglass Figures
If you’ve got an hourglass shape, pencil skirts or A-line black skirts will highlight your curves beautifully. High-waisted styles are also a great option to accentuate your waist. The goal here is to balance the proportions and make the most of your curves.
4.2 For Apple Shapes
For apple-shaped bodies, you’ll want a black skirt that creates some flow around the waist and hips. A-line and pleated skirts are great options here. They add volume and help balance the upper body. A midi skirt is also a fab choice as it won’t cling to the waist but will still look flattering.
4.3 For Plus-Sized Bodies
Plus-size bodies can look fantastic in A-line and high-waisted black skirts. These styles help create a flattering, elongating look. A pleated black skirt can also add some fun movement while still giving you a stylish shape. Midi or maxi skirts offer comfort and style in equal measure, and they’re perfect for almost any occasion.

6. How to Care for Your Black Skirt
6.1 Washing and Drying Tips
Taking care of your black skirt is super important to keep it looking sharp. For most black skirts, wash them in cold water to preserve the fabric and color. If it’s a delicate fabric like satin or silk, dry cleaning is the safest bet. For denim or cotton skirts, machine wash them inside out to protect the color.
6.2 Storing Black Skirts Properly
Store your black skirt in a cool, dry place to avoid any fading. For pleated skirts, use a hanger with padded clips to keep the pleats intact. If your skirt is leather, make sure not to hang it for too long to avoid stretching.
Table: Black Skirt Styles vs. Occasion
| Black Skirt Style | Best For | Occasions |
|---|---|---|
| Mini Black Skirt | Casual, Daytime | Shopping, Weekend Outings, Casual Lunches |
| Midi Black Skirt | Versatile, Semi-formal | Office, Brunch, Day Dates |
| Maxi Black Skirt | Elegant, Formal | Weddings, Evening Galas, Formal Events |
| Pencil Black Skirt | Professional, Tailored | Office, Business Meetings, Formal Work Events |
| Pleated Black Skirt | Playful, Casual | Day Out, Semi-formal Events, Date Nights |

FAQs
What Shoes Should I Wear with a Black Skirt?
It all depends on the vibe you’re going for! Sneakers or ankle boots are perfect for casual days, while heels or pumps give you that elegant, polished look for formal occasions.
How Can I Style a Black Skirt for the Office?
Pair a pencil black skirt with a fitted blouse, a blazer, and some classic heels for a work-appropriate look. For a more relaxed office, swap in a midi skirt and a tucked-in sweater.
What Fabrics Are Best for a Black Skirt?
Denim is great for casual wear, while leather black skirts are perfect for nights out. Satin or silk black skirts are ideal for formal occasions, offering that luxe touch.
